Her hairstyles are as versatile as her outfits. She effortlessly rocks loose, wavy hair for a casual, breezy vibe, often seen in her modern photoshoots. For traditional events, a classic, neatly tied low bun adorned with fresh flowers is her go-to, adding an elegant and sophisticated touch. She also experiments with voluminous high ponytails for edgy, power-dressing looks, showing her ability to adapt her hair to the mood of her outfit.

While many actresses from the 90s transitioned to modern western wear, Devayani’s photoshoots continue to celebrate ethnic grandeur The Classic Era Her early photoshoots from films like Suryavamsam defined the "Tamil Ponnu" (Tamil girl) look. This involved: Traditional (half-saree) sets. A signature small bindi and jasmine flowers in her hair.
As her career progressed into the 2000s and transitioned into television hit series like Kolangal , her style adapted to the needs of the modern working woman.
